Grammy Award-winner Rhiannon Giddens is a masterful singer, banjo and fiddle player, blending American musical genres like gospel, jazz, blues and country. Her elegant, prodigious voice and fierce spirit come alive in her performances, bringing audiences to their feet, whilst showcasing her extraordinary emotional range and dazzling vocal prowess. She sold out the Royal Festival Hall at the EFG London Jazz Festival, was a member of the Carolina Chocolate Drops, has released four incredible albums on Nonesuch, and is part of the collaborative project Our Native Daughters

Filmed especially for Voices of Hope from their current home of Ireland, she joins fellow multi-instrumentalist Francesco Turrisi to perform excerpts from their forthcoming album, They’re Calling Me Home, written during the pandemic, taking deep dive into the musical meaning of home; the comfort of home and belonging as well as the “call home” of death, which has been a tragic reality for so many throughout the past year. This follows their previous album there is no Other
